Output 2bd81b41e09fced7d9a101b4e5bbadeb7344094b69acfdbe2ae7d55545e80f4d:159

value
297389
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2644ade5ea98e6ca6acb35b06e867a030686eea OP_EQUAL
address
3HxGM8anH2arrveRLUL3YHX13JzNQJ2Unc
transaction
2bd81b41e09fced7d9a101b4e5bbadeb7344094b69acfdbe2ae7d55545e80f4d
confirmations
163323
spent
true